Hello Friends, I hope you are having a terrific Tuesday!

Recently, I read an article that had suggestions on the products that you should and should not buy at your local Dollar Stores.  I agreed that buying party supplies and paper products was a good idea and with not buying toys which may contain high levels of lead.  Purchasing cleaning supplies saves money, but I only buy name brands because some of the others are watered down which makes them a waste of money.

The only statement in the article that I did not agree with was that food items should never be purchased.  Granted there are some items in a Dollar/99 Cents store that shouldn’t be purchased because of it’s obvious non-compliance with FDA’s regulations, however, there are a lot of products that I would and have bought at Dollar Tree stores.

snacks

The state of the economy has forced us all to be more frugal but my sons are trying to eat me out of house and home!  They are always snacking and can easily polish off a large bag of chips in one sitting…wonder where they got that from (lol).  Therefore, I am always on the hunt, usually with coupons in hand, in search of snacks that they will eat and be satisfied without breaking the bank.

That’s where Dollar Tree comes in, and it has always been my “go to” store for snacks, even when the boys were small, it was the place to stop before going to the movies.   Not all products are sold in all stores and I was surprised with what I found in their freezer section, taking note that packaging was clearly marked Made in the USA, (The Bronx, NY, Altoona, PA, Pennsauken, NJ and Rancho Cucamonga, CA).   There are many name brand products made specifically for non-grocery type stores as evidenced by their sizes, however, the quality remains the same and manufacturer’s coupons are accepted.

First State Saves Week Celebration

On Thursday, Delaware Financial Literacy Institute (DFLI) celebrated “America Saves Week” with an Awards luncheon held at the Junior Achievement building in Wilmington. Board members, business owners, volunteers, and politicians were invited to attend in honoring Debra Forbes, RN, BSN, MS from Governor Bacon Health Center and Jim Godfrey, President/CEO of Consumer Credit Counseling Services of MD & DE, Inc.

The Money School of Delaware

The Honorable Robert Glen, State Bank Commissioner presented the awards and spoke about the First State Saving’s Bank At School programs.  With each new branch opening the ribbon cutting ceremony includes entertaining plays that shows students the importance of saving money.

Debra Forbes was honored for creating onsite financial training programs.  These United Way sponsored events are held during normal business hours making it convenient for attendees.  Jim Godfrey was honored for partnering with The Money School in assisting consumers with debt reduction and credit counseling.  Arming consumers with important financial tools has a positive impact on the community as a whole.

JA3

JA2

Kamysha Martin, representing Theatrical Fusion, presented a DVD entitled “Shopaholics”, designed upon the reality TV concept but with a twist.  These free web based videos were created for teens and young adults to educate them about finances.  As an introduction to the world of budgeting, debt management, smart spending, and debit vs credit card usage.  Financial management is something that either parents or schools should teach but when it’s not, by the time they enter college it’s possibly too late, something I can personally relate to!

The unique concept of this program is that it gives the viewers the ability to choose the ending scene which is then played out accordingly.  The DVD also featured Intervention classes as a follow up, these web based video can be seen here.

JA4

The Honorable Governor Jack Markell gave a brief history about The Money School of Delaware.  

In 1999, The Money School launched it’s first 1 day conference with few attendees, but today has over 600 programs within the state of Delaware.  Instructors are all volunteers, and a small staff of 6 operates the main office.  Ronni Cohen, Executive Director of DFLI works diligently with the Governor to ensure the successful growth of these programs in the state.
